CN Bridge lane shift on Highway 7 plus line painting at Keele and Edgeley

March 17, 2016

Starting tomorrow, crews will be line painting westbound lanes on Highway 7 at Keele, then shifting the lanes over the CN Bridge to the north. Crews will also be re-painting traffic lines at the intersection of Edgeley/Interchange & Highway 7. Please see below for details on the traffic shift and temporary lane closures:

map-CB_H2_2016_03_14

work dates*: Friday, March 18 to Thursday, June 30
work hours: 24-hours/day

what you need to know:

  • Crews will be working on a number of construction activities in the median, including road work, storm sewer and expansion joint installation work in order to continue with the progress on the CN Bridge.
  • To accommodate these work activities, on Friday, March 18, crews will be line painting on Highway 7 westbound, west of Keele, as early as 9am to shift lanes to the north side of the bridge. This lane shift will be in place for approximately three months.
  • Westbound traffic on Highway 7 between Keele Street and Creditstone Road will reopen to two lanes, shifted to the north.
  • Following the completion of the line painting at Highway 7 and Keele, crews will then move to the Edgeley/Interchange & Highway 7 intersection to touch up traffic lines.
  • The line painting work will require short-term lane closures and will occur between 9:00am–3:30pm.
  • Due to the nature of this work, at times there will be noise and vibration around the work area.
